Practical Algorithms for Programmers. Andrew Binstock, John Rex

Practical Algorithms for Programmers


Practical.Algorithms.for.Programmers.pdf
ISBN: 020163208X,9780201632088 | 220 pages | 6 Mb


Download Practical Algorithms for Programmers



Practical Algorithms for Programmers Andrew Binstock, John Rex
Publisher: Addison-Wesley Professional




The statement is simple, but its implications are deep – at Lock-free programming aims to solve concurrency problems without locks. In this paper, we study the relational consistency Title. I hated having to study full year of physics, thought my software engineering class was at least two years behind the times, learned operating systems and languages that were twice as old as me, and pulled an all-nighter at least twice a semester trying to finish a nearly-impossible algorithm (I still hate you, Dynamic Programming). For example, homework 1 is the shotgun method for genome sequencing, a parallel algorithm of considerable practical importance and renown. Look at Bob Muenchen's book (or this article) for practical examples of R functions to replace SAS macros. Writing lock-free code is difficult. Consistency properties and algorithms for achieving them are at the heart of the success of Constraint Programming. The practical and obvious reason for a degree is to get a job. Computer Science classes are useless and difficult. A simple algorithm based on an old dynamic programming concept provides an effective and practical approach to such problems. Most SAS programming probably gets done by writing SAS macros. Instead, lock-free algorithms rely on atomic primitives Lock-free algorithms are not always practical. Formally, a multi-threaded algorithm is considered to be lock-free if there is an upper bound on the total number of steps it must perform between successive completions of operations. Significant practical improvements to the original dynamic programming method have been introduced, but they retain the O(n3) worst-case time bound when n is the only problem-parameter used in the bound.

More eBooks:
Radiologia de Huesos y Articulaciones download